An update on my previous post which was titled something along the lines of 'car juddering when stationary.'
I am posting on my sisters behalf, she has a Golf mk4, 1.4 S-reg.
It has been really juddering when she is stationary, ie at traffic lights etc. Despite whether its in neutral or in gear it still judders. :aargh4:
She has recently had spark plugs, HT lead & oxygen sensor changed and also paid for VW to look at it...£200 later, they cannot find the cause :zx11: but have stated the problem as that the car is 'misfiring under 2000rpm'
What would cause this as VW cant even find the problem!!
Also, VW stated her cam belt is a bit loose and makes a noise (but my sis said its been like that since shes had it and never affected anything...however, could it be that the fact this is a bit loose is causing this misfiring, as VW were trying to persuade her to pay ££££'s to have it replaced.
Can someone please shed light on what is causing this. Nothing showed up on a diagnostic scan.
